“New” to Ram HD Forum. I have a 2015 2500 6.7 CTD. Just took it to a trusted diesel mechanic (not a dealership) for a check engine light (107,000). Got the callback: bad turbo… $5,800 in parts, and top with labor. Ouch.
So, the question begs, how often do turbos “go bad”? Did I pick a bad year (bought used with only 64k on it)?
I know it’s worth fixing, as I don’t have $100k or so sitting around to try to buy a new one, but…
Is this a ”normal/semi-normal” thing that happens? How long should the turbo last?
 
If my brother in law wasn't a diesel tech for ram, I would have someone either prove to me what's wrong or get a second opinion.
 
Coulda been built on a Monday morning or Friday after lunch. Anything man made can and will fail. Some just prematurely go out. May have been dirty oil, may have been coked oil, etc. too many variables to know why it went out but from my understanding a turbo can last as long as the engine. Had the dreaded 6.5 in a Chevy 3500 with 157k on it. Turbo went out. Seen other engines with half a millions miles with original turbo. I’m sure someone more knowledgeable will chime in.
